Hi wesyde,
The warning reported here typically indicates that it took longer for your system to resume from suspend than expected. I believe there is a 5 sec barrier which your system likely exceeded. Based on your dmesg output I see PM: resume devices took 5.136 seconds. I'm setting this to traiged for further investigation. Thanks!
